Joy Ann Schmitz Landreneau entered this world on May 8, 1942, and entered Heaven on June 2, 2025.
Born in New Orleans to Jules and Lucille Schmitz, she is survived by her sons Darren Landreneau (Meredith) and Jeff Landreneau (Michelle), Son in Law Joseph Hargrave, his sons Marcus (Angie) and Jacob (Jozette Dupont), and her grandchildren Crystal Lejeune (Keith), Zachary, Ian, Christopher, Nicholas, and Madeline (aka Suzy), great-grandchild Kevin Lejeune, several nieces and nephews. She also leaves behind her second family, the children of her twin sister Julie, her niece Becky Prima (Gordon) and nephew Brian Rosa (Angella).
Joy was preceded in death by her parents, her husband of 61 years, Andrew “Peewee” Landreneau, their daughter Michele “Missy” Hargrave, and her twin sister and brother-in-law Julie and Freeman Rosa.
Joy was employed with Key Color Laboratories and Professional Color for over 30 years. Joy enjoyed working and spending time with friends. She loved to hang out with coworkers and some high school friends at Picadilly’s and New Orleans Hamburgers and Seafood. She loved their gumbo! She always enjoyed spending time with her children, grandchildren, and great-grandchild Kevin.
If Joy loved you, she loved you fiercely!
Joy was a caring and loving sister, wife, mother, and friend. She will be missed by many that have known her.
A memorial service to celebrate Joy’s life with her family and friends will be Sunday, June 22 from 11 AM to 2 PM at Bagnell & Son Funeral Home, 75212 Hwy 437, Covington, La 70435.
